Quality Assurance Specialist

HYH America - Irvine, CA

Apply Now

Job Description

About HYH AmericaHYH America Inc. is a U.S.-based subsidiary of hy Co., Ltd., a South Korean leader in fermented dairy, functional beverages, and health-focused nutrition with over 50 years of innovation. Building on hy's legacy of pioneering wellness solutions for millions of households, HYH America represents the company's strategic expansion into the United States market.More than a product-driven business, HYH America is a purpose-led venture committed to shaping everyday lifestyles. Our mission is to inspire Healthier Habits and Happier Cultures, bringing together thoughtfully crafted wellness products, community, and cultural experiences to create a more balanced and joyful way of living. Through health innovation, authentic collaborations, and culturally relevant engagement, HYH America is redefining how wellness is experienced across America and beyond.Position OverviewThe QA Specialist will play a critical role in ensuring product quality, food safety, and regulatory compliance across all manufacturing operations. This position focuses on in-process quality control, co-packer (OEM) management, and the continuous improvement of quality systems. The ideal candidate is a proactive problem-solver who can identify risks, drive corrective actions, and support successful product launches in a fast-paced, growth-stage environment.Key ResponsibilitiesIn-Process Quality Control & Continuous ImprovementPerform in-process quality inspections and ensure compliance with established quality standardsLead continuous improvement initiatives across manufacturing processes and product qualityEstablish, standardize, and implement quality criteria consistently across all production sitesConduct product safety evaluations and ensure adherence to food safety requirementsChange Management & Risk AnalysisPerform risk assessments for product or process changes and identify preventive measuresSupport validation of process changes and ensure quality consistency throughout implementationProactively flag emerging risks and drive timely corrective actionCo-Packer (OEM) Quality ManagementConduct regular audits of co-packers and OEM partners to verify compliance with internal quality standardsReview and evaluate OEM quality systems and food safety programsEnsure ongoing alignment with company expectations and applicable regulatory requirementsCOA Review & Data AnalysisReview Certificates of Analysis (COA) for raw materials and finished goodsAnalyze quality data trends to detect process variability and drive data-informed decisionsImplement and track corrective and preventive actions (CAPAs) to resolutionNew Product Launch SupportPartner with cross-functional teams to support new product launches by verifying formulation accuracy, process conditions, and finished product quality at OEM sitesEnsure production readiness and full compliance with specifications during initial production runsQualificationsRequiredBachelor's degree in Food Science, Microbiology, Chemistry, or a related fieldBilingual fluency in English and Korean (written and verbal)Proficiency in Microsoft Excel; comfort working with quality data and reportsStrong organizational, communication, and cross-functional collaboration skillsDetail-oriented with a high level of accuracy and a willingness to learn in a fast-paced environmentAbility to manage multiple priorities and remain effective under pressurePreferred3-5 years of experience in food or beverage quality assurance/quality controlExperience managing co-packers or OEM manufacturing partnersWorking knowledge of beverage manufacturing processes and quality control methodsFamiliarity with FSMA, HACCP, SQF, or equivalent food safety frameworksExperience with CAPA systems and quality management softwareWork EnvironmentThis is a fully on-site position based at our Irvine, CA office, Monday through Friday. Occasional travel to co-packer or OEM facilities may be required for audits and launch support activities. The role may also require schedule flexibility to support collaboration with HYH's Korea headquarters across time zones.Compensation & BenefitsThe base salary range for this position is $70,000 - $90,000 per year, commensurate with experience, qualifications, and demonstrated expertise in food and beverage quality assurance.In accordance with California law (SB 1162), HYH America provides pay transparency for all open positions. Final compensation will be determined based on the candidate's relevant work experience, skill set, and alignment with the role requirements.HYH America offers a competitive benefits package, including company-paid medical coverage (100% of employee premiums, with 20% employer contribution for eligible dependents), 12 days of accrued PTO per year, and 11 company-designated paid holidays.
